Some torque converters use several stators and/or various turbines to supply a broader range of torque multiplication. This kind of many-element converters are more typical in industrial environments than in automotive transmissions, but automotive apps like Buick's Triple Turbine Dynaflow and Chevrolet's Turboglide also existed. The Buick Dynaflow used the torque-multiplying characteristics of its planetary equipment set along with the torque converter for minimal equipment and bypassed the initial turbine, applying only the second turbine as car pace greater.

A torque converter cannot reach one hundred pc coupling efficiency. The vintage three factor torque converter has an efficiency curve that resembles ∩: zero performance at stall, usually rising effectiveness over the acceleration section and reduced efficiency within the coupling period.

The loss of efficiency given that the converter enters the coupling period can be a result of the turbulence and fluid flow interference created through the stator, and as previously stated, is commonly defeat by mounting the stator with a a single-way clutch.
